Report: Vernon Adams hurt finger last week, aims to start vs. Spartans

Oregon Ducks quarterback Vernon Adams Jr. suffered an index-finger injury on his throwing hand against Eastern Washington last weekend, according to a report by ESPN. Adams also left that game after taking a brutal hit late in the fourth quarter.

According to the report, Adams has been icing his hand.

Despite the injury, Adams intends to start Saturday against Michigan State.
In his first start for the Ducks, Adams was 19-of-25 for 246 yards and two touchdowns. He also added 94 yards on the ground in Oregon's 61-42 victory.
